
About Electrical CAD
Electrical CAD is a specialized type of computer-aided design software that focuses on creating, modifying, analyzing, and optimizing electrical designs. It’s widely used for wiring diagrams, circuit layouts, control panels, PLC programming layouts, and electrical schematics.
